Perched atop the prominent Achalm mountain at an elevation of 707 meters, the Achalm Castle Ruins and Tower stand as a historic landmark overlooking the towns of Reutlingen and Pfullingen in Baden-Württemberg, Germany. This captivating site, situated at the edge of the Swabian Alb, offers a unique blend of medieval history and natural beauty, making it a significant historical site and a popular viewpoint in the region.

While largely a ruin, visitors can still observe the impressive 18-meter-high stone lookout tower, which was rebuilt in 1838 on the foundations of the original keep. Beyond the tower, you can find remnants of the outer walls, parts of the trench system, and visible building foundations that hint at the castle's once larger structure, including a fore-castle and multiple baileys.

Achalm Castle can be visited in winter, offering unique snowy vistas. However, conditions can be challenging. The uphill climb may be slippery due to ice or snow, and temperatures will be cold. It's essential to wear appropriate winter hiking gear, including sturdy, waterproof boots with good grip, warm layers, and potentially microspikes if conditions are icy. Always check local weather forecasts before heading out.

The hike to Achalm Castle is generally considered family-friendly due to its relatively short duration, typically around 20 minutes from the base. While it involves an uphill climb, it's manageable for most active children. There isn't a strict recommended age, but children who are comfortable with a moderate uphill walk will enjoy it. The panoramic views and historical ruins provide engaging points of interest for all ages.

Achalm mountain stands at an elevation of 707 meters (approximately 2,319 feet). The hike to the summit involves an uphill climb, but it is generally considered manageable for most fitness levels. The terrain is a mix of paths and trails. While not overly strenuous, it provides a good workout, and the reward of panoramic views from the top is well worth the effort.
Yes, public transport options are available to reach the general area. You can take local buses or trains to Reutlingen, which is just 3.5 km from the castle. From Reutlingen, you may need to walk or take a short taxi ride to reach the trailhead or a suitable starting point for your hike up to the ruins.
